Виды

Тема в разделе "Lotus - Программирование", создана пользователем nila, 5 май 2008.

  1. nila

    nila Гость

    Привет Лотусистам!
    Как уходят от этой проблеммы. Очень долго открываются категаризированные виды( много документо)
    Есть какое то решение... как уйти от этого?
     
  2. Sandr

    Sandr Гость

    база индексирована?
     
  3. nila

    nila Гость

    Ага. Индексированная(
    И ссылка на базу, когда я письмо отправляю. Тоже открывается безумно долго
    Что это проблемма из-за категаризации?
     
  4. Alexander (Criz)

    Alexander (Criz) Гость

    Можно поподробнее?
    Используются ли в доках Readers поля, есть где-нибудь в селекте или в формулах колонок конструкции с использованием @Today или @Now, сколько документов в базе и важнее как много меняется доков за какое время...
     
  5. nila

    nila Гость

    Каждый месяц я агентом создаю документы, где то 1010 каждый месяц. Это опрос документы (Вопрос-ответ).
    И потом эти документы люди заполняют уже. Когда создаю эти документы отправляю ссылку на базу. для каждого человека... на базу так надо.
    Я имитировала и внесла за три месяца. то есть доков получается по 4 тысячи.
    Виды открываются безумно долго.
    В видах категаризация 3 уровней!!!
    Виды такого типа
    По дате, по статусу.

    Скрытия колонок взависимости от доступа нет... думала об этом.
    А как вообще правильнее
    - Просто делать разные виды? и Оутлайны. для разного уровня доступа.
    - или нужно использовать одни виды... просто скрывая колонки?

    Плодить виды и оутлайны не хочется... и грузить базу. Но со скрытием колонок тоже не понятно хорошо это или нет.

    Проясните пожалуйста...
     
  6. Kee_Keekkenen

    Kee_Keekkenen Well-Known Member

    Регистрация:
    5 сен 2006
    Сообщения:
    616
    Симпатии:
    4
    стремитесь использовать по возможности минимальное количество видов, колонок и категорий в них..
    чем всего этого меньше, тем меньше индекс (размер) бд и выше быстродействие интерфейса...
    используйте свойство вида свернуть все при первом открытии бд при большом объеме данных с категориями вид открывается заметно быстрее
     
  7. Medevic

    Medevic Что это ? :)
    Lotus team

    Регистрация:
    10 дек 2004
    Сообщения:
    3.346
    Симпатии:
    2
    nila
    Так @Today или @Now используется или нет?
     
  8. Sandr

    Sandr Гость

    Вообще даже очень нагруженные представления не должны открываться настолько долго, что успеваешь замучаться... Что у вас за железка? Скока оперативы, какая операционка... Настроен ли DBCach ? Делаеться ли по ночам фиксап с компактом?
    Попробуйте прибить индексы и создать их заново...

    Ньюансов много и даже @Today с @Now не должны сильно влиять...
     
  9. nila

    nila Гость

    Да наверное проблемма в том, что база не успевала индексироваться. А я ее юзала.
    Полей @Now нет.
    А вот все таки как лучше, и как быть если.
    Это нормально для разного уровня доступа использовать свои Outline. И показывать там только его виды?

    Это к тому что я не знаю. как быть с видами. Чтоб их меньше было...
    Использовать один вид и скрывать колонки от доступа?
    Потому что. У меня такая проблемма.(
    Есть несколько уровней доступа. Вид категаризированный по этим трем доступам.
    И я хочу что бы При открытии вида люди видели только свои документы.
    Например директор (их несколько), манаджер (их несколько), магазин (кол-во)
    Я все нормально прописываю в ридерс поля... что б они видели только те доки которые надо.
    Но в виде... показываются все!
    но только если нажимаешь не на свой документ, то он не открывается.
    А мне надо что б показывало только те которые открываются... только те которые его доки.
     
  10. K-Fire

    K-Fire Гость

    Похоже у вас идекс вью сглючил. Попробуйте через Shift-F9 (кажется) перестроить индекс. Если не поможет, удалите вьюшку из базы совсем, а потом заново создайте.

    Outline для разного уровня доступа использовать нормально.
     
  11. Medevic

    Medevic Что это ? :)
    Lotus team

    Регистрация:
    10 дек 2004
    Сообщения:
    3.346
    Симпатии:
    2
    Может нужно поставить галку Don't show empty categories в свойствах представления?
     
  12. Sandr

    Sandr Гость

    Вы как проверяли, что в виде есть все документы? Меняли учетки на своей машине, или бегали по рабочим местам пользователей? Локальный кеш - глюкавая штука, иногда бывает и такое, как Вы описали.. Попробуйте ничего не делать, а пройтись по рабочим местам пользователей и посмотреть, что они видят..

    ЗЫ: Индекс на всякий пожарный пересоздайте... и сделайте
    Код (Text):
    lo updall путь к базе -R
    в консоли сервера
     
  13. Constantin A Chervonenko

    Constantin A Chervonenko Well-Known Member

    Регистрация:
    30 май 2006
    Сообщения:
    1.288
    Симпатии:
    0
    Не поставить, а УБРАТЬ! Открытие вьюхи на 5-10 тыс док-тов она тормозит существенно
     
  14. nila

    nila Гость

    Привет ребята!
    Да сейчас когда я поставила on't show empty categories в свойствах представления.
    Все показывается правильно, видят пользователи только те документы в которых они в ридерс полях.
    Но вы говорить , что это плохо для видов, если будет много документов.
    Как же быть тогда?


    Я меняю id, и захожу под разными правами.
    База на сервере.
    Четко юзер видет все документы в категориях. Но когда нажимаешь на док не его, то этот документ он не может видеть.
    А в представлениях показывает.

    Галка Don't show empty categories в свойствах представления
    работает с этой проблеммой.
    Но другое "но" документов будет много, и как это будет ок?
     
  15. Medevic

    Medevic Что это ? :)
    Lotus team

    Регистрация:
    10 дек 2004
    Сообщения:
    3.346
    Симпатии:
    2
    Сделать выбор. :)
     
  16. Sandr

    Sandr Гость

    nila
    Если на одной машине со чменой учеток - это кеш.. бывает такое...
     
Загрузка...
Похожие Темы - Виды
  1. KiR
    Ответов:
    5
    Просмотров:
    6.089
  2. NickProstoNick
    Ответов:
    2
    Просмотров:
    1.941
  3. NickProstoNick
    Ответов:
    8
    Просмотров:
    3.564

Поделиться этой страницей